A systemic herbicide, absorbed through roots, with acropetal translocation in the xylem. Applied to the soil, it acts as a broadleaf weed preemergence since it is absorbed through the roots and transported to the aerial part of plants.
Sulphate of Ammonia is a quick acting, nitrogen fertilizer which encourages green and leafy growth. It is especially beneficial for crops such as lettuce, spinach, leeks and onions. As a water-soluble fertilizer, Sulphate of ammonia is extensively used for crop production because it provides efficient nitrogen and readily available Sulphur which aids in plant growth.
